  1. This time around I volunteered at the Humane Society in Bloomington. This is a local non-profit local shelter that finds homes for abused and unwanted pets. Overall I enjoyed this experience. I love working with animals and it felt good to help out.
  2. The major purpose for the participants at the Humane Society was mostly to care for the animals. Most of the volunteers took the dogs on walks, socialized with the cats and cleaned their rooms.
  3. The activities that I partook in went from walking the dogs and cleaning the cat rooms. The items I needed for the dogs was a leash and plastic bags, and for the cats I needed a scoop for the litter, and cleaning spray to wipe down surfaces. There were first aid kits behind the front desk in case of any bites or scratches. There were 10 different volunteers which were split up evenly between all of the jobs.
  4. There was a registration class that needed to be completed before the actual volunteering, as well as a waiver form that needed to be completed prior to working.
